Thalassemia is a major health problem in Iran. The prevalence of thalassemia minor is high and screening program for detecting beta -thalassemia trait has been established in southern parts of Iran since 1992. To determine the efficacy of naked-eye single-tube red cell osmotic fragility test [OFT] as a screening test for beta -thalassemia trait. Three different concentrations [0.36%, 0.37% and 0.38%] of buffered saline solutions were used. OFT were applied to three groups of subjects: 50 normal individuals, 50 subjects with genetically proven beta -thalassemia trait, and 15 patients with proved iron-deficiency anemia. The results demonstrated that 0.37% saline was the best solution for OFT. It could detect 98% of heterozygous beta -thalassemia patients compared to 96% and 84% detection rate obtained with respective 0.36% and 0.38% saline. Specificity of OFT with 0.37% saline was 96% whereas that of 0.36% and 0.38% saline were 84% and 94%, respectively. The OFT with 0.37% saline was also positive in 5 [33.3%] patients with iron-deficiency anemia. OFT done with 0.37% buffered saline solution provides more accurate results. Since the test is inexpensive and practical it might be considered as the single screening test to be used in areas with limited laboratory facilities and economic resources

Se comparan 3 pruebas de laboratorio para el diagnóstico de la microesferocitosis, la prueba cuantitativa de hemólisis a 3 concentraciones de NaCl, la denominada "prueba rosada" y la prueba del glicerol acidificado. Los resultados que se obtuvieron en 62 contoles y en 40 casos de microesferocitosis indican que la prueba más confiable, específica, simple y barata, es la prueba del glicerol acidificado
